Alpha Compute Continues to Grow Technical Execution and Client Support Teams for Scaling Global AI Infrastructure BusinessNew York, NY, Aug. 24, 2026 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- Alpha Compute Corp. (NASDAQ: ALP) ("Alpha Compute" or the "Company"), a high-performance GPU infrastructure and confidential-compute technology company serving the artificial intelligence economy, today announced additional appointments to its Global Infrastructure Business. The appointments are designed to enhance the technical execution and client support team behind a rapidly growing Global Infrastructure sales pipeline. Anne Schoofs has been appointed Vice President, Client Success, Global Infrastructure Business, where she will lead the charge in managing our strategic enterprise accounts, ensuring that our clients' high-density compute and AI infrastructure deployments operate at peak efficiency. Her leadership will be instrumental in driving seamless technical onboarding, optimizing workload performance, and building enduring partnerships as we expand our global data center capabilities. Jose Rios joins as Advisor, Global Infrastructure Business, providing counsel on silicon strategy, high-density compute architecture, and data center design as the Company scales its Blackwell-class fleet.
